[发明专利]一种CDN路由实现方法和系统有效
申请号: | 201210209758.7 | 申请日: | 2012-06-25 |
公开(公告)号: | CN103516606B | 公开(公告)日: | 2017-08-11 |
发明(设计)人: | 陶全军;郝振武 | 申请(专利权)人: | 中兴通讯股份有限公司 |
主分类号: | H04L12/721 | 分类号: | H04L12/721;H04L12/741 |
代理公司: | 北京派特恩知识产权代理有限公司11270 | 代理人: | 张颖玲,张振伟 |
地址: | 518057 广东省深圳市南山*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 cdn 路由 实现 方法 系统 | ||
技术领域
本发明涉及通信领域,具体涉及一种内容分发网络(Content Delivery Network,CDN)路由实现方法和系统。
背景技术
目前,互联网流量中90%以上的流量都是网页数据、文件共享、视频类的可重复内容,这些流量采用缓存、转发的模式更为高效,而现有的IP网络支持的是端到端的传输模型,在现有互联网流量特征下是低效的。
进几年,学术界开始研究将互联网改造为以内容传输为中心的缓存转发模式,比如将主机之间通信的基本原语从原来IP的连接-发送/接收报文的形式改为无连接的内容/数据读取/订阅,网络设备设置内容缓存,并解析主机发出的内容读取请求,如果命中本地缓存则立即返回结果,否则继续在网络中路由。
在内容中心网络(Content Centric Network,CCN)或者数据命名网络(Named Data Networking,NDN)中,每个内容切片有唯一的命名,采用统一资源标识(Uniform Resource Identifier,URI)的格式,CCNx开源项目中将CCNx作为URI方案,并考虑切片的版本、切片和摘要签名。比如一个内容源切片的标识可以为CCNx:a.example.com/video/a.wmv/v1/s3/EFCD 1234AB....,其中最后的一串数字表示切片的摘要签名,倒数第二个s3表示第3个切片,v1标识版本为1。
当上述标识转换到内容切片协议中时,为了方便路由设备的处理,采用长度值(Length-Value)的方式进行编码。仍以上述URI为例,报文传输格式如表1所示:
表1
其中每个字段的第一个字节表示字段长度,后续为标识段的内容。
CCN/NDN命名采用分层的方式来汇聚路由表,但这种方式存在问题:根据统计,目前互联网中,顶层域名已达到N=2x10^8,采用现有的CCN/NDN命名路由技术,会加大CCN/NDN的边际网关路由器路由表的压力。
发明内容
有鉴于此,本发明的主要目的在于提供一种CDN路由实现方法和系统,以解决CCN/NDN网络中的边际路由器(BR)路由表过大的问题。
为达到上述目的,本发明的技术方案是这样实现的:
一种内容分发网络CDN路由实现方法,该方法包括:
内容路由器收到用户的内容请求消息,所述请求消息中包含内容标识Content ID和内容源初始域ID;
所述内容路由器在本自治域中匹配所述Content ID,如果匹配上,则优先在本自治域中获取内容;否则,转发所述内容请求消息至内容边际路由器,内容边际路由器根据所述内容源初始域ID,将所述内容请求消息转发至内容初始域边际路由器;所述内容初始域边际路由器通过所述Content ID在本自治域中找到目标内容。
所述Content ID用于域内路由,所述内容源初始域ID用于域间路由。
该方法还包括:用户获取目标内容列表;以及,所述内容初始域边际路由器将找到的目标内容返回给用户。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中兴通讯股份有限公司,未经中兴通讯股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210209758.7/2.html,转载请声明来源钻瓜专利网。
- 上一篇:收集粉尘的切割机
- 下一篇:路由传输方法和装置及系统